Date: Thursday 14th March 2013 br Speaker: Daniel Greb (Bochum) br Title: Compact moduli spaces for slope-semistable sheaves br br Abstract: While the variation of moduli spaces of H-slopeGieseker-semistable sheaves on surfaces under change of the ample polarisation H is well-understood, research on the corresponding question in the case of higher-dimensional base manifolds revealed a number of pathologies. After presenting these, I will discuss recent joint work with Matei Toma (Nancy), which resolves some of these pathologies by looking at curves instead of divisors. This naturally leads to the question whether higher-dimensional analogues of the Donaldson-Uhlenbeck compactification exists, and I will discuss our construction of such a compactification.
